1 definition by TheFreshmanOf2016

A stuck up public school located in North Arlington where the girls are ugly and the boys are asses. Yorktown's team is "The Patriots" which is ironic because everyone there acts like a bunch of upper class anarchists. Really everyone here just wishes they studied harder and made it into the most boss school, H-B Woodlawn
Person A: Why's that guy such an asshole?

Person B: He's from Yorktown High School

Person A: Oh, I should have known that
by TheFreshmanOf2016 September 16, 2012